Recently, it has reached the harvest period of pepper. China has a long history of pepper cultivation, and the quality of pepper is superior. At present, from planting, harvesting, drying, screening to processing, in the pepper industry chain, the drying, screening and deep processing equipment of pepper has been developed and promoted. Some pepper processing equipment has been improved and innovated on the basis of the original, so that the pepper granules and pepper seeds are more pure, continuously improve the efficiency of the pepper industry, and expand the “flower pepper economy†to help fight poverty. The picking period of a 2019 year has arrived. A grower purchased a pepper electric dryer to solve the traditional daily drying of four or five hundred kilograms. When it rains, there is no place to dry, and peppers in a few days. It will black out and other problems, while the power consumption is small, and the power consumption is only 1.5 degrees in one hour. In addition, some farmers have purchased a color sorter that can filter the pepper particles in the pepper seeds to avoid the pepper seeds in the artificial screening, and there are many pepper particles, and the peppers that have been purchased after the oil is extracted. The seeds are cleaner.
Not only that, but a company in the area has invested in a supercritical carbon dioxide extraction production line and is currently in the process of commissioning. It is understood that the extracts produced by the company are extracted by physical methods, which not only can ensure the original flavor of pepper, retain the active ingredients, and the production volume will be 2.5 times of the original production line. The process is more reasonable, the energy consumption per unit is reduced, and the output is reduced. rise.
Thermal spray wires are typically made from materials such as metals, alloys, or ceramics. They are available in various diameters and compositions to suit different applications and requirements. The wire is fed into a thermal spray gun, where it is heated to a molten state and propelled onto the surface being coated.
The thermal spray process offers several advantages, including the ability to apply coatings with excellent adhesion, corrosion resistance, wear resistance, and thermal insulation properties. It is commonly used in industries such as aerospace, automotive, oil and gas, power generation, and manufacturing.
Some common types of thermal spray wires include:
1. Metal wires: These wires are made from materials like aluminum, zinc, stainless steel, nickel, and copper. They are used for applications such as corrosion protection, thermal barrier coatings, and wear resistance.
2. Alloy wires: These wires are composed of a combination of different metals or metal alloys. They are used to create coatings with specific properties, such as high temperature resistance, electrical conductivity, or improved mechanical strength.
3. Ceramic wires: These wires are made from ceramic materials such as aluminum oxide, zirconia, or tungsten carbide. They are used for applications requiring high wear resistance, thermal insulation, or electrical insulation properties.
Overall, thermal spray wires play a crucial role in the thermal spraying process, enabling the creation of high-performance coatings for a wide range of industrial applications.
